Overview and History
Founded in 1956 as the Guangzhou Physical Education Institute, GZSU has grown into southern China’s leading university for sports science, physical education, and athletic training. Its relocation to No. 1268, Guangzhou Avenue Middle in 1960 marked the beginning of decades of educational and architectural development. The university’s emblematic ram’s head shield and rich traditions reflect the growth of sports culture in Guangzhou.

Visiting Information: Hours and Tickets
- General Visiting Hours: Monday to Friday, 8:00 AM–6:00 PM; Saturday, 9:00 AM–4:00 PM.
- Admission: General campus access is free. Some facilities, such as sports museums or special exhibitions, may require a small entry fee.
- Guided Tours: Available upon advance booking via the university’s administrative or international office. Guided tours offer in-depth exploration of campus history, sports facilities, and research centers.
- Special Events: Tickets for sporting events, competitions, or public workshops vary by event and are best reserved online or at the campus ticket office.

Getting There
- By Metro: Take Guangzhou Metro Line 1 or Line 3 to Tianhe Sports Center Station; the campus is a 10-minute walk from the station.
- By Bus: Multiple bus routes pass along Guangzhou Avenue Middle, stopping near the main campus entrance.
- By Taxi or Ride-Share: Taxis and ride-sharing services are widely available in Guangzhou.
- Bicycles: Public bike rental stations are located near campus entrances.

Facilities and Campus Attractions
Academic and Research Facilities
- Lecture Halls and Labs: State-of-the-art spaces for biomechanics, physiology, and sports psychology.
- Library: Comprehensive sports science collections, study areas, and digital resources.
Sports Complexes
- Main Stadium: 400-meter running track, professional turf, and spectator seating.
- Indoor Sports Arena: Equipped for basketball, volleyball, badminton, and gymnastics.
- Swimming Complex: Olympic-standard pools for swimming, diving, and synchronized swimming.
- Martial Arts Hall: Designed for wushu, taekwondo, and judo.
- Outdoor Facilities: Football pitches, tennis and basketball courts, and dedicated track and field zones.
Cultural and Visitor Spaces
- Sports Museum: Exhibitions on Chinese sports history, university achievements, and alumni.
- Conference and Event Halls: Venues for academic forums and public events.
- Retail Outlets: Shops for sports equipment, university merchandise, and daily essentials.
Sustainability Initiatives
The campus integrates green technologies such as solar panels, energy-efficient buildings, and recycling programs.
